English: Hydraulic engines Cross Keys Bridge By Sir W G Armstrong, Whitworth & Co Ltd, Elswick works, Newcastle-upon-Tyne. Three cylinder oscillating engines with reversing motion. Duplicated for redundancy. Uses high pressure water - the original "hydraulic" before this new-fangled oil hydraulic stuff. These are below the floor of the central control cabin and we saw them trundled round, disengaged from the drive.
They are still in situ but they are disengaged and the bridge is now turned by small oil hydraulic engines (both working together) under computer control. |
